Drains in road gutters – known as gullies – help stop flooding by diverting rainwater away safely.

Or at least that’s the idea.  Too often they seem to be blocked.

As well as helping to keep our area working well  by reporting when things go wrong, we can also help prevent problems arising.  For example, gullies block when too much solid material goes down them, so muck from driveways, sand from laying paving and the like should not be hosed down into the gutter.
